Pharmacist - Staff (Beaumont - Mon-Fri with occasional Saturday)
2 weeks ago
As a Staff Pharmacist at our mail order pharmacy, you will play a crucial role in the safe and efficient dispensing of prescription medications through mail order pharmacy services. This position involves accurately verifying and filling prescriptions, providing pharmaceutical counseling to patients, and ensuring compliance with all applicable regulations and standards. You will work in collaboration with pharmacy technicians and other healthcare professionals to deliver high-quality pharmaceutical care to patients, embodying our core values of integrity, compassion, dedication, collaboration, and resourcefulness.
This position will report directly to the COO, Pharmacy Division.
KEY TASK A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Prescription Verification and Dispensing:
- Review and verify prescription orders for accuracy and appropriateness with unwavering integrity.
- Accurately dispense prescription medications, ensuring proper labeling and packaging, while showing compassion for patients' well-being.
- Maintain a strong focus on medication safety, preventing errors, and addressing any potential issues promptly.
- Patient Counseling:
- Provide medication counseling to patients with dedication, including dosage instructions, potential side effects, and drug interactions.
- Address patients' questions regarding their medications with empathy and compassion.
- Offer guidance on medication adherence and lifestyle modifications to optimize outcomes.
- Medication Management:
- Manage medication inventory with resourcefulness, including ordering, receiving, and restocking.
- Monitor medication storage conditions to ensure stability and compliance with regulations, upholding our commitment to integrity.
- Conduct routine inspections and quality checks to maintain the highest standards of care.
- Regulatory Compliance:
- Stay up to date with federal and state pharmacy laws, regulations, and industry best practices, demonstrating our dedication to compliance.
- Ensure compliance with pharmacy policies, procedures, and safety protocols.
- Maintain accurate records of all prescription transactions and required documentation.
- Collaboration:
- Collaborate with healthcare providers and prescribers to resolve medication-related issues, showcasing your collaborative spirit.
- Coordinate with pharmacy technicians and support staff to streamline workflow and maintain efficiency.
- Assist in the development and implementation of pharmacy quality improvement initiatives through teamwork.
- Customer Service:
- Provide excellent customer service, addressing patient inquiries and concerns in a professional and empathetic manner, embodying compassion.
- Maintain a patient-centric approach, ensuring a positive patient experience with each interaction.
- Continuing Education:
- Engage in ongoing professional development to stay current with emerging pharmaceutical trends and therapies, demonstrating dedication to lifelong learning.
- Attend training sessions, conferences, and workshops to enhance knowledge and skills with resourcefulness.
QUALIFICATIONS
- Bachelor's or Pharm. D. degree from an accredited school of pharmacy.
- Valid licensure as a Registered Pharmacist in the state of Texas.
- Maintain education and certifications as required by applicable State Board of Pharmacy.
PROFESSIONAL SKILLS, EXPERIENCES AND COMPETENCIES
- Strong interpersonal skills and demonstrated professional and technical competence.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, both internally and externally.
- Able to support multiple tasks, initiative, and responsibilities simultaneously.
- Must possess strong professional ethics.
- High attention to detail and able to handle a fast-paced environment.
- Proficient in Microsoft Office suite and industry related software platforms.
- This position operates within a clean and well-lit environment.
- May require standing or sitting for extended periods and the ability to lift and carry prescription orders or supplies.
